FashionIncomingPeter Jensen and Tim WalkerJensen has notched up another stellar collaboration with photographer Tim Walker for an installation at Dover Street Market.ShareLink copied ✔️September 28, 2009FashionIncomingPeter Jensen and Tim Walker The journey across Greenland, which Peter Jensen wholeheartedly undertook when researching for his A/W 09 collection, continues with a special installation at Dover Street Market, created in collaboration with photographer Tim Walker.It was the perfect opportunity for the two creative dreamers, who are long standing friends, to create a bespoke environment where an army of penguins will be taking over the store windows. "Working with my friends at Dover Street Market, and with Tim has been a fantastic opportunity to bring creativity and commerce together in an interesting and unique way," explains Jensen.Jensen's special capsule range, exclusive to Dover Street Market will sit in the installation and consists of pieces like beaded knitwear, panelled wool dresses and faux fur leggings. Following a previous prints-redux collection that Jensen did for Dover Street Market, the designer has once again created special prints for the store, the first of which is a lady bird print by Jensen and then a further print designed in collaboration with Walker that consists of a combination of grinning moons, handwritten musings and ladybirds.
